When it comes to efficiency and reliability, nothing can beat lithium-ion batteries. However, for off-grid storage systems, the lead-acid battery may be a better choice for a number of reasons. Basically, both types of storage units can store energy effectively, but both have their own advantages and disadvantages. Below are some points of comparison between the two. cost

Cost is one of the main factors that draw a line between the two. If you get two batteries of the same capacity, the lithium-ion battery will cost you three times as much. Depending on the size of the system you want to install, this can add significantly to your expense.

Although lead-acid batteries have relatively lower price tags, they may not last as long as their counterparts.

Ability

The capacity of a battery pack refers to the amount of energy it can store. The good thing about these batteries is that they have a higher energy density than their counterparts. Therefore, these units can store more energy without taking up additional space. Therefore, you can install more of these units in less space.

discharge depth

The depth of discharge of a battery is the percentage of the energy that can be drained without causing any damage to the unit. The disadvantage of lead-acid batteries is that they cannot be depleted by more than 50%. On the other hand, lithium-ion batteries can be safely discharged down to 85% of their capacity.

Efficiency

Another good point of comparison is the efficiency of these units. Unlike lead-acid batteries, lithium-ion batteries offer 95% more efficiency. In other words, 95% of the energy stored in these units can be used. On the other hand, the other type of battery offers only 85% efficiency.

Life expectancy

Like solar panels, batteries continue to degrade over time. As a result, they lose their efficiency. After recharging a battery, when it discharges completely, it is considered a discharge cycle. In terms of the number of discharge cycles, lead-acid batteries cannot beat lithium-ion batteries. Therefore, the latter offers a much longer service life.

Should you install a lead-acid battery or a lithium-ion battery?

If you need to install a backup system, you can opt for a lithium-ion battery or a lead-acid battery. However, since the former offers so many advantages, you may not want to opt for lead-acid battery packs. Although lithium-ion units are higher in cost, they offer a great return on investment for many reasons explained above.

However, if you don’t want to use your battery packs very often, lead-acid batteries may be your ideal choice.
